Brad photographed this Rufous-tailed Jacamar, Galbula ruficauda, while we were birding the lowlands near Pereque in Brazil on October 18, 2011. This male has a white throat and a long dark bill. The upperparts and breast are greenish, and the underparts and tail are rufous. This bird has some blue on the head and wing coverts. Temperatures were in the upper 70's on this partly cloudy morning.
